补充牛初乳后进行运动和热暴露:胃肠道与免疫功能综述

Exercise and exposure to heat following bovine colostrum supplementation: a review of gastrointestinal and immune function.

作者信息

Carrillo A E, Koutedakis Y, Flouris A D

机构信息

Centre for Research and Technology Thessaly FAME Laboratory, Institute of Human Performance and Rehabilitation Trikala Greece.

出版信息

Cell Mol Biol (Noisy-le-grand). 2013 Nov 3;59(1):84-8.

PMID:24200023
Abstract

Colostrum is the first milk produced by mammalian mothers and is essential for the health and survival of the newborn. Bovine colostrum (BC) has greater concentrations of the bioactive components (i.e. immune and growth factors) than those found in human colostrum. As a result, BC supplementation has been recently adopted by many sport competitors as a means of enhancing immune function as well as improving performance. Improvements in physical performance associated with BC supplementation may stem from the ability of BC to maintain gastrointestinal (GI) integrity by decreasing GI permeability. During exercise in the heat, blood flow to the GI tract is reduced that leads to endotoxin leakage into circulation. Endotoxins, such as lipopolysaccharide, can trigger an inflammatory cascade leading to physiological strain that, in turn, increases heat storage and decreases time to exhaustion. GI permeability is lessened during passive heat stress following BC supplementation, but the influence of BC supplementation on GI function during exercise heat stress remains to be determined. The implications of endotoxemia during exercise in the heat is a matter of growing importance and warrants further study given the global increase in ambient temperatures during sport competitions.

摘要

初乳是哺乳动物母亲分泌的第一乳,对新生儿的健康和存活至关重要。牛初乳(BC)中生物活性成分(即免疫和生长因子)的浓度高于人初乳。因此,最近许多体育运动员采用补充牛初乳来增强免疫功能并提高成绩。与补充牛初乳相关的体能改善可能源于牛初乳通过降低胃肠道(GI)通透性来维持胃肠道完整性的能力。在热环境中运动时,流向胃肠道的血流量减少,导致内毒素泄漏到循环系统中。内毒素,如脂多糖,可引发炎症级联反应,导致生理应激,进而增加热量储存并缩短疲劳时间。补充牛初乳后,在被动热应激期间胃肠道通透性会降低,但补充牛初乳对运动热应激期间胃肠道功能的影响仍有待确定。鉴于体育比赛期间全球环境温度升高,热环境中运动期间内毒素血症的影响日益重要,值得进一步研究。
